| Dishwasher Powder For Stubborn Linen Stains
|
|
For getting spots out of fine linen, soak in 1 Tbsp of dishwasher machine powder. If stubborn, add a few drops of bleach (if white). If not white, add 30% peroxide.

| Swiffer Dusters are Washable
|
|
Swiffer disposable dusters are washable.Just throw in with a regular load of washing, hang to dry and get more uses out of them. You can also spray with a little 'endust' to help trap the dust.

| Cleaning with Odor-free Oven Cleaner
|
|
Odor-free Oven Cleaner is especially great for cleaning dirty can openers and tops of kitchen waste cans.

| Using Tea Tree Oil for Cleaning
|
|
Using 2 cups of water and several drops of pure tea tree oil will clean dirt off windowsills, and clean mostly anything wooden. Also use tea tree oil, diluted with water and sprayed on a child's hair, keeps the lice away.

| Store Wipes Upside Down
|
|
When storing the disinfecting wipes (that I use daily!), turn the container upside down and the wipes will not dry out so quickly.
